Three is
// deliberate: most failures are transient node evictions that resolve
// within two retries, while anything persisting past three is almost
// always a malformed source file that no amount of retrying fixes.
// Do not raise this without checking queue-depth dashboards first,
// since extra retries compound backlog during peak ingest.
// This value was last validated against the farm build noted below.

pipeline stamp: htk4_ae36

# Licensing Dispute — Varell Components (Restricted: Managers)

For the incoming director. Summary: Varell Components alleges our Stonebridge firmware uses their codec beyond the evaluation license. Claim filed last quarter. Exposure: moderate; counsel rates their position weak on scope, stronger on duration. Current status: mediation scheduled. Engineering has a replacement codec at 80 percent readiness. Do not discuss externally. Decisions pending: settle, fight, or swap and settle small. Strategic context sits in the note below.

internal memo for kawip-hadug: Headcount on the Wenwyn team goes from 7 to 140 by the end of January. Gross margin on Wenwyn came in at 20 percent against a plan of 15 percent.

Briefing for the Board: Support Outsourcing Proposal

Management proposes transferring first-line customer support for the Ombrelle platform to Calverton Response Group under a three-year agreement. Diligence covered service quality, data handling, and staff redeployment at the Fenwick site. Projected savings reach 18% of support costs by year two, with defined exit clauses.

The board is asked to consider the strategic context summarized immediately below.

board note of bagug-kafof: The steering committee signed off on a budget of $55.0 million for Project Fraox. The renewal with Fenvanek Freight closes at $37.0 million a year, 4 percent above the last contract.

Handover — Vexler partner SFTP drop

Ownership moves to you today. Drop runs hourly from Vexler's end into the intake bucket via the relay host. Watch for zero-byte files; their exporter flakes on Mondays. Creds live in the ops vault, path noted in the runbook. Vault auto-seals after 48h idle. Support escalations go to the on-call rotation, not me. If the vault is sealed when you need it, unseal with the recovery passphrase below.

recovery phrase for tadug-fafof: zorwyn-kasion